Cinnaminson Winterfest Approaching

The Cinnaminson Elementary Home and School Association's annual fundraiser is for the kids in more ways than one.

Winter may not officially start until Dec. 21, but Cinnaminson School District’s annual Winterfest is just around the corner.

The Cinnaminson Elementary Home and School Association’s (CEHASA) biggest fundraiser of the year will be held Sunday, Dec. 8, at Cinnaminson High School.

Organizer Christine Turner said the Association decided to make a slight change this year and bring the festival back to its more kid-centric roots. In addition to the roughly 100 crafters/vendors displaying and selling their wares, she said there will be musical entertainment—provided by Cinnaminson students—including the Cinnaminson High School Marching Band, which will escort Santa (who will be arriving by fire truck) into the high school.

The event will also feature the ever-popular “Sweets and Treats Lane,” where guests can purchase a cookie container and fill it with assorted home-baked goods.

And don’t forget Santa’s Workshop, featuring an assortment of kid activities: donut-decorating; face painting; festive hat-making; and various other crafts for children.

Admission to Winterfest is totally free. However, the Christmas laser light show—held at 1 p.m. in the high school auditorium—has a $2 cover charge. The show was held for the first time last year and is already one of the festival’s most popular attractions, according to Turner.

“Kids love the laser light show,” she said.

There will also be plenty of food (in addition to the sweets) served at the event, including pizza, hoagies, hot dogs and more.

Proceeds benefit the Cinnaminson Elementary Home and School Association, which funds a multitude of extracurricular activities and programs for elementary students.

“Our children benefit hugely from the things CEHASA does,” said Turner. “Without these fundraisers, there would be no extra activities for children, no family fun nights, no playground equipment.”
